How Kiki Cuyler's Hits Compares to Similar Players

Kiki Cuyler totaled 2,299 career Hits, well above the league average of 470.7 — a mark that ranked among the best of his era. His best Hits season came in 1930, posting 228, well above the league average of 66.3 that year. The lowest point came in 1921 at 0, well below the league average of 67.9 that year. Production slipped through the final seasons. The Hits total went from 185 in 1936 to 110 in 1937 and 69 in 1938, falling over the span. The decline marked the closing chapter of the career. Significant season-to-season variance characterizes the Hits profile — ranging from 0 to 228 — though the career average remained well above league norms.
